Put on

verb
Word Frequency: 23.1

Definitions

1.verbTo don (clothing, equipment or the like).
"Why don't you put on your jacket. It's cold."
2.verbTo fool, kid, deceive.
"She's putting on that she's sicker than she really is."
3.verbTo assume, adopt or affect; to behave in a particular way as a pretense.
"He's just putting on that limp -- his leg's actually fine."
4.verbTo play (a recording).
"Can you put on The Sound of Music? I'd like to see it again."
5.verbTo initiate cooking or warming, especially on a stovetop.
"I'll put on some coffee for everybody."
6.verbTo perform for an audience.
"The actors put on a show."
7.verbTo organize a performance for an audience.
8.verbTo hurry up; to move swiftly forward.
